开发一个具备高通过率且用户体验优秀的借贷平台,核心在于构建一套精准风控与极致体验并重的技术架构,解决用户关于借贷平台哪个好贷款容易通过审核的痛点,不在于单纯降低审核门槛,而在于利用大数据与人工智能技术,更精准地识别优质用户,实现秒级审批与差异化授信,以下是基于微服务架构与智能风控模型的系统开发深度教程。
系统架构设计:高并发与低延迟的基石
要实现贷款容易通过审核,首先必须保证系统在高并发下的稳定性,避免因系统崩溃导致的审核失败,推荐采用Spring Cloud Alibaba或Go-Zero作为微服务核心框架,将系统拆分为用户中心、订单中心、风控中心、支付中心等独立模块。
-
服务拆分策略:
- 用户服务:负责注册、登录、实名认证(OCR+人脸识别)。
- 进件服务:负责借款申请填写、资料上传、合同生成。
- 风控服务:核心模块,独立部署,通过RPC调用进行实时决策。
- 贷后服务:负责还款计划生成、扣款、催收管理。
-
数据库优化:
- 采用MySQL分库分表策略,按用户ID取模分片,确保单表数据量控制在500万以内,提升查询效率。
- 引入Redis集群缓存热点数据,如用户token、额度信息、风控规则配置,减少数据库IO压力,将接口响应时间控制在200ms以内。
智能风控引擎开发:提升通过率的核心
风控系统的优劣直接决定了审核的通过率与资产质量,传统的规则引擎已无法满足需求,必须开发基于机器学习的大数据风控决策引擎。
-
数据源接入与清洗:
- 多源数据集成:接入央行征信(或百行征信)、运营商数据、公积金、社保、电商消费数据、银行卡流水等。
- ETL处理:使用Flink进行实时数据清洗,将非结构化数据(如文本、地址)转化为结构化特征向量,确保数据的准确性与时效性,这是提高审核通过率的数据基础。
-
特征工程构建:
- 基础特征:年龄、职业、收入、负债比。
- 衍生特征:近3个月平均月消费、近6个月借贷申请次数、夜间活跃度、设备指纹稳定性。
- 交叉特征:收入与居住地消费水平的匹配度、职业与负债的合理性。
-
模型算法选择与训练:
- 反欺诈模型(GBDT/XGBoost):利用知识图谱技术,识别团伙欺诈与中介包装,通过分析设备关联、IP关联、联系人关联,将欺诈用户拦截在申请之外,从而为真实优质用户释放额度。
- 信用评分卡(Logistic回归/LightGBM):训练A分卡(申请评分)和B分卡(行为评分),将用户划分为A+到F多个等级,针对不同等级设置自动通过阈值,A+级用户全自动秒批,无需人工干预。
-
决策流配置:
- 开发可视化的规则配置后台,支持热更新,策略如下:
- 第一层:黑名单校验(法院执行、失信名单)。
- 第二层:反欺诈模型校验(设备指纹、IP异常)。
- 第三层:信用评分模型校验(预测违约概率)。
- 第四层:人工复核(针对边缘灰度用户)。
- 开发可视化的规则配置后台,支持热更新,策略如下:
审核流程优化:用户体验与效率的平衡
为了让用户觉得“贷款容易通过审核”,前端交互流程必须极简,同时后端逻辑必须严密。
-
智能填单技术:
- 集成OCR SDK,用户拍摄身份证、银行卡即可自动识别姓名、卡号,减少手动输入错误。
- 引入RPA(机器人流程自动化)技术,在用户授权后自动抓取运营商、公积金数据,免去用户手动上传截图的繁琐步骤,降低用户流失率。
-
全流程自动化审批:
- 预审机制:用户注册登录后,后台即触发“预授信”计算,让用户在未借款前就能看到预估额度,增强借款信心。
- 实时反馈:风控引擎采用同步调用模式,用户提交申请后,系统在3秒内完成风控决策并返回结果,避免长时间等待导致的用户焦虑与取消申请。
-
差异化授信策略:
不要搞“一刀切”,针对信用极好的用户,开发“快贷”通道,只需三要素即可放款;针对信用一般的用户,增加辅助认证项(如联系人、社保),给予其补充资料提升通过率的机会,而不是直接拒绝。
核心代码实现逻辑示例(风控调用部分)
以下是基于Java的简化版风控决策调用逻辑,展示如何将风控引擎嵌入进件流程:
public LoanApprovalResult processLoanApplication(LoanRequest request) {
// 1. 基础校验
if (!validationService.validateBasicInfo(request)) {
return LoanApprovalResult.reject("基础信息不完整");
}
// 2. 调用风控引擎(核心)
RiskDecisionResponse riskResponse = riskEngineService.decision(request.getUserId(), request.getAmount());
// 3. 处理风控结果
switch (riskResponse.getAction()) {
case APPROVE:
// 4. 额度定价
Quotation quota = pricingService.calculateQuota(request.getUserId(), riskResponse.getScore());
return LoanApprovalResult.approve(quota);
case REJECT:
return LoanApprovalResult.reject("综合评分不足");
case MANUAL:
// 5. 转人工审核
manualReviewService.submitToQueue(request);
return LoanApprovalResult.pending("人工审核中");
default:
return LoanApprovalResult.reject("系统异常");
}
}
安全与合规体系建设
在追求高通过率的同时,必须确保系统符合金融监管要求,否则平台无法长久运营。
-
数据安全:
- 敏感数据(身份证号、银行卡号)必须使用AES-256加密存储,密钥与数据分离管理。
- 接口传输采用HTTPS + 双向认证,防止中间人攻击。
-
合规性控制:
- 综合年化利率(IRR)计算:系统需内置精确的IRR计算器,确保展示给用户的利率不超过法定上限(24%或36%)。
- 授信额度管控:根据监管要求,严格控制多头借贷,接入征信共享平台,防止用户过度负债。
总结与独立见解
开发一个让用户感觉“容易通过”的平台,本质上是数据维度的竞争与算法精度的竞争,很多平台通过拒绝所有风险用户来保证安全,这虽然安全但牺牲了用户体验,专业的解决方案是:利用知识图谱挖掘深层关系,精准剔除欺诈分子;利用机器学习细化用户分层,为不同风险等级的用户匹配差异化的产品(如分期长短、利率高低),只有当系统能够在毫秒级时间内,从海量数据中准确还原用户的真实信用画像,才能真正实现“好用户秒批,差用户秒拒”,从而在市场中建立起“借贷平台哪个好贷款容易通过审核”的良好口碑。






